ST-1~20 Torque Meter
The ST Series Digital Torque Meter is developed to test and measure various types of torque, making it ideal for motorized or air-driven clamps, torque screwdrivers, and torque spanners. It is widely used for testing wrench force and fracture force in industries such as electronics, light manufacturing, machinery, and scientific research.
This torque meter is perfect for ensuring accurate torque measurements and calibration in various applications, contributing to both quality control and research needs.
Key Features:
- Peak holding and auto-release functions with customizable hold times (1-10 seconds).
- Automatic power-off feature with user-adjustable timing (1-60 minutes) for safety and battery conservation.
- Tolerance comparison feature with Go/NG indicators based on preset limits.
- Memory function stores up to 10 test results with average calculation.
- Automatic conversion between units (N.m, kgf.cm, lbf.in).
- RS-232C output for data transmission and analysis through external equipment.

ST-B Torque Meter
The ST-B Series Cap Torque Meter is a smart and precise metrologic instrument designed for measuring and calibrating the torque torsion of cap approvals and closures. With an easy-to-use clamping system that can handle cap diameters up to 200mm, this device is perfect for industries requiring fast and accurate torque measurements. The built-in printer and RS-232C output allow for data transmission to computers, enabling further analysis and enhanced reporting capabilities.
This torque meter is ideal for industries focusing on cap closures, ensuring accurate and reliable torque measurement for quality control.
Key Features:
- Connects to a computer for real-time force value curve viewing via testing software.
- Built-in printer for outputting testing curves and analysis of up to 10 groups of data.
- Programmable automatic power-off function (1~60 minutes) for energy efficiency.
- Automatic unit conversion (N.m, kgf.cm, lbf.in) for convenience.
- Memory function that stores up to 10 test results with automatic average calculation.
- Upper and lower limit setting with sound and light alarm notifications.
- Adjustable peak holding time (1~10 seconds) to suit different testing requirements.

HP Torque Meter
The HP Series High Impact Torque Tester is an intelligent and multi-functional instrument, specifically designed for high-impact testing and torque measurement. It is ideal for testing and calibrating various electric and pneumatic drivers, torque screwdrivers, wrenches, and fasteners, as well as for conducting torque fracture tests. The HP Torque Meter offers easy operation, high accuracy, and a complete feature set in a portable design, making it a valuable tool in industries such as electrical, light manufacturing, machinery, and scientific research.
Key Features:
- Suitable for testing high-torque speed electric and pneumatic tools.
- Peak hold function captures the peak torque value, with adjustable auto-release timing.
- Comparison function allows input of tolerance limits (Max/Min), with visual Go/No-Go (NG) indicators via green/red pilot lamps.
- LED display with torque direction indicator and blue backlight for clear visibility.
- Memory function stores up to 10 test data points and calculates the average for easy reporting.
- Automatic unit conversion (N.m, kgf.cm, lbf.in) ensures seamless measurement adaptability.
- Programmable automatic power-off function (1-60 minutes) for energy saving and safety.
- RS-232C output for easy data transmission to a computer for further analysis.

STW Full-Automatic Torque Tester
The STW Full-Automatic Torque Tester combines advanced electronic technology with precise mechanical drive for superior performance in torque testing. It features accurate loading speeds and a wide test range, ensuring high precision and sensitivity in loading, deformation, and angle measurements.
The STW Full-Automatic Torque Tester is ideal for demanding applications requiring precise and reliable torque measurement and control.
Key Features:
- Automatic Power Off: Configurable to turn off after a set period of inactivity.
- High Accuracy Sensor: Ensures reliable and precise test results.
- Digital Servo Drive System: Provides efficient, low-noise operation with excellent stabilization.
- Automatic Return: Returns to the starting position automatically after each test.
- Two-Speed Mode: Offers high-speed approach and low-speed collection for versatile testing.
- Unit Options: Automatically converts between N, kgf, and lbf units.
- Data Storage: Saves up to 10 test values and 3 groups of test curves.
- Multiple Test Modes: Includes manual, constant torque, and constant angle modes to meet various testing needs.
- TFT Colorful Screen: Features an 800×480 pixel display with touch functionality, showing peak values, real-time data, and force curves simultaneously for comprehensive monitoring.
